Kariya, situated in central Aichi Prefecture, Japan, is a city that harmoniously combines urban and suburban living. With a population of over 153,000, it provides a vibrant yet comfortable environment for residents and visitors alike. The city is known for its cultural heritage and offers a glimpse into Japanese city life away from the bustling tourist centers. Its strategic location makes it a convenient spot for exploring the broader Aichi region.
Kariya is well-connected by public transport, making it easy to explore the city and surrounding areas.

Spring is a beautiful time to visit Kariya with mild temperatures and cherry blossoms.
Summers can be hot and humid, but it's a vibrant time with local festivals.
Fall offers pleasant weather and stunning autumn foliage.
Winters are mild, making it a great time to explore cultural sites without large crowds.
